To support customer demand, we are currently seeking a HGV Class 1 Driver at our Hams Hall depot.

Shift Available: HGV Class 1 Driver: 4 on 4 off Nights (Start times around 15:00-19:00)

Rate of pay: £16.54 per hour, plus a combined shift allowance of £95.00 per week, paid weekly. Overtime rate: after 39 hours worked each week is paid at time and a half.

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Ensure the vehicle is legal and roadworthy at all times - all daily checks are completed, and any vehicle defects are reported.
  • Ensure the correct goods have been loaded and are secure before moving the vehicle.
  • Carry out trunking and multi-drop deliveries in a timely manner and in accordance with the law (including drivers working time regulations).
  • Double check deliveries with the customer whilst providing a polite and helpful experience.
  • Obtain relevant signatures and paperwork before returning to your home depot.

What are we looking for?

  • Someone with a C+E driving licence, a valid in‑date DigiTacho and CPC.
  • Previous Class 1 driving experience.
  • Someone who can lift up to 18kg.
  • You must be able to communicate clearly with other team members in English.
